High-Visibility Clothing and Accessories

High-visibility clothing and accessories are vital components of motorcycle rider visibility techniques. These garments are specifically designed using bright colors, reflective materials, and fluorescent fabrics to enhance the rider’s conspicuity in various lighting conditions.

Bright colors such as neon yellow, orange, and lime green are highly recommended because they stand out in daytime and low-light environments. Reflective strips or patches further improve visibility by reflecting ambient light, especially at night or during inclement weather.

Accessories such as reflective vests, arm and leg bands, and backpacks with reflective elements can be added to standard riding gear for increased safety. Wearing high-visibility gear not only makes the rider more noticeable to other drivers but also helps in preventing accidents by improving overall road awareness.

Investing in high-visibility clothing and accessories aligns with motorcycle rider visibility techniques aimed at reducing blind spots and increasing predictability. Properly chosen gear ensures riders are seen earlier and more clearly, significantly contributing to safer riding practices.

Proper Headlight Usage During Day and Night

Proper headlight usage is a fundamental motorcycle rider visibility technique to enhance safety during both day and night riding. During daylight hours, rider headlights should be turned on consistently to increase visibility and alert other drivers of your presence, even in well-lit conditions. This practice helps reduce the risk of accidents caused by unseen motorcycles.

At night, correct headlight operation becomes even more critical. Riders must ensure their headlights are properly aligned, providing maximum illumination of the road ahead without blinding oncoming traffic. Utilizing high beams when appropriate, such as in poorly lit areas or open roads, can significantly improve visibility but should be dimmed or dipped when approaching other vehicles.

Additionally, maintaining headlights is essential for their effectiveness. Regular checks for functionality, cleanliness, and proper aim ensure they perform optimally. Using bright, well-maintained headlights as part of your motorcycle rider visibility techniques can markedly reduce accidents and increase safety for both the rider and others on the road.

Utilizing Additional Lights and HID Kits

Utilizing additional lights and HID kits significantly enhances motorcycle rider visibility, especially in low-light conditions or adverse weather. These auxiliary lighting systems provide increased brightness and a broader light spread, making the motorcycle more conspicuous to other drivers.

HID (High-Intensity Discharge) kits are popular for their superior illumination compared to standard halogen bulbs. They produce a brighter, more intense light while consuming less power, which can improve visibility without compromising motorcycle electrical systems. However, proper installation is essential to ensure they do not create glare for other road users or violate local regulations.

Adding supplementary lights, such as fog lights or LED accent lights, can further improve visibility from various angles. These lights help motorcyclists stand out during rainy or foggy conditions, reducing the likelihood of accidents. It is advisable to select lights that comply with legal standards and are appropriately aimed to prevent dazzling other drivers.

Overall, utilizing additional lights and HID kits is an effective motorcycle rider visibility technique, but it requires responsible installation and adherence to safety regulations to maximize benefits safely.

Maintenance and Inspection of Visibility Equipment

Regular maintenance and inspection of visibility equipment are vital for ensuring motorcycle rider visibility techniques remain effective. Riders should routinely check all lighting components, including headlights, tail lights, brake lights, and turn signals, for functionality and damage. Any malfunction or dimming can significantly reduce visibility to other drivers.

Cleaning visibility equipment also plays a critical role. Dirt, grime, and debris can diminish the brightness of lights and obscure reflective surfaces. Using appropriate cleaning solutions and soft cloths helps maintain optimal visibility, especially during adverse weather conditions. Inspecting reflective materials on high-visibility clothing and gear is equally important and should be done regularly for wear or fading.

Additionally, securing all electrical connections is essential to prevent flickering or failure. Loose or corroded wiring can compromise the performance of lighting systems, increasing safety risks. If any components show signs of damage or malfunction, prompt replacements or repairs are necessary to uphold visibility standards. Implementing routine inspection protocols ensures that visibility equipment functions optimally, directly enhancing motorcycle rider visibility techniques and overall safety on the road.

Poor Lane Positioning in Traffic

Poor lane positioning in traffic significantly affects motorcycle rider visibility, increasing the risk of accidents. Riding too close to the curb or the right edge can make a rider less noticeable to other drivers. Maintaining a central or lane-positioning strategy enhances visibility and safety.

Proper lane positioning also involves avoiding blind spots of larger vehicles, such as trucks and buses. Staying within the lane’s center or slightly to the left of the lane helps other drivers see the motorcycle more clearly. This practice reduces the chances of being hidden in other drivers’ blind spots.

Additionally, lane positioning can communicate the rider’s intentions clearly. For example, shifting left or right within the lane signals lane changes, helping other motorists anticipate movements. Such visibility techniques contribute greatly to overall motorcycle safety in traffic.

Consistent awareness of environmental factors and traffic flow is essential. Poor lane positioning, especially in heavy traffic, can cause confusion or misjudgments by other drivers, compromising visibility. Correct lane positioning is a fundamental part of motorcycle rider visibility techniques that promote safer road sharing.
